Output d3c8838116adf30dc2559031d2d8771f843cf5e5283968be762d99c2870c01a9:0

value
2850829
script pubkey
OP_0 OP_PUSHBYTES_20 18d848f8b711c91475e8a248de1fda260fcf7d24
address
bc1qrrvy379hz8y3ga0g5fydu876yc8u7lfyc92yws
transaction
d3c8838116adf30dc2559031d2d8771f843cf5e5283968be762d99c2870c01a9
spent
true